• 《数据挖掘系统支撑下的高考志愿填报在线咨询系统设计与实现》论文笔记(十二)


    一、基本信息

    标题:数据挖掘系统支撑下的高考志愿填报在线咨询系统设计与实现

    时间:2012

    来源:西南大学

    关键词:数据挖掘; OLAP; 高考志愿填报在线咨询系统; SSH框架;

    二、研究内容

    1.主要内容

      数据挖掘系统建设和数据挖掘系统支撑下的高考志愿填报在线咨询系统建设是整个项目的两个阶段。在整个项目中,借助数据挖掘技术,研究、分析高考招生电子数据,依据该数据建立了数据仓库,通过过程为数据仓库装载了数据,在数据仓库基础上进行建立了多个多维数据集(CUBE),然后在上CUBE进行OLAP分析与数据挖掘。招生数据挖掘系统发现了许多有价值的信息,其中包括志愿填报方面的有用信息,将志愿填报方面的信息作用于填报咨询系统,填报咨询系统通过结合考生信息,经过分析处理,得出最恰当的填报指导。论文具体研究内容如下:

    (1)通过ETL为数据仓库导入招生电子数据,建立TEL包,为后续的数据清洗、转换、加载提供支持。

    (2)在数据仓库的基础上建立多维数据集,选定主题,通过联机分析处理技术中的切片、钻取等功能对选取的维度进行多层次分析,根据主题采用不同层次的聚合以提高查询与分析的效率,并且以直观明了的方式(如报表,图表等)生成分析结果。

    (3)在多维数据集上,采用决策树、关联规则和神经网络等九种数据挖掘算法进行相关主题的数据挖掘,找出数据中潜在的有价值的信息和知识。

    (4)设计有效的填报咨询系统模型,设计挖掘接口以使招生数据挖掘系统能够为填报咨询系统提供挖掘服务,实现挖掘信息和考生相关信息的综合分析以提供科学、准确的志愿填报指导。

    2.论文结构

      第一章:绪论。主要介绍本课题的研究背景、内容和意义,并阐述与课题相关的技术研究和应用现状,最后介绍了文章的结构框架。

      第二章:相关理论与技术。主要介绍填报咨询系统采用的平台与相关技术,以及招生数据挖掘系统所采用的解决方案的相关理论、技术和工具。

      第三章:填报咨询系统分析与设计。主要介绍系统的分层结构模型,各层的主要分工,并对填报咨询系统的主要功能、建设方案进行介绍。

      第四章:填报咨询系统的实现。依据总体设计和功能设计,基于相关平台和技术,实现填报咨询系统,并对实现过程中的关键问题进行阐述。

      第五章:后台数据挖掘系统的支撑。主要介绍某省招生数据挖掘系统的总体结构和具体功能的实现步骤,并对它的支撑作用进行阐述。

      第六章:志愿填报咨询实例剖析。主要内容是模拟考生或家长使用系统,对系统功能的使用进行说明,并展示系统在指导过程中的人机交互。

    3.填报咨询系统分析与设计
    (1)系统需求分析

      易操作性:在调査中我们发现,大部分考生,特别是家长对特定的信息系统存在着使用障碍,通常得花费较多时间去熟悉系统。因此,系统的人机交互需要满足易用性(如简单的注册、登录,友好的错误提示和操作提示等),让考生和家长通过简单的操作即能使用功能。

      院校、专业推荐:通过抽样调査以及参考网上数据,有近的考生和家长看重专业,因此,我们需要在志愿填报的时候提供院校优先或专业优先两
    种选择,并提供打印对比,让考生能够自主地选择最满意的推荐结果。

      关联推荐:在和考生交流中我们发现,由于全国高校、专业数量众多,考生通常难以完全掌握所有高校和专业的信息,因此,需要系统自动推荐符
    合考生条件的、能录取的相关专业或院校。

    (2)系统总体设计

    (3)系统主要功能

    三、结论

      通过阅读论文。了解到填报咨询系统的整个方案,以及与招生数据挖掘系统的关联关系。通过项目初步试运行表明,基于招生数据挖掘来建立填报咨询系统是有很高的可行性和应用价值。论文中的数据挖掘系统支撑下的高考志愿填报在线咨询系统以某省招生数据挖掘为依托,综合考虑考生、院校、政策等各方面情况,能够得出相对更加准确的填报指导。本文主要工作包括:(1)维护数据仓库,并导入招生电子数据,基于数据仓库建立多个多维数据集。(2)确定主题,在基础上进行分析和数据挖掘,提出决策分析报告,并设计实现院校、专业的关联规则挖掘接口。(3)在招生数据挖掘系统基础上设计与实现填报咨询系统,为考生和家长提供相对准确的志愿填报指导服务。

    四、参考文献

    [1]肖灿数据挖掘系统支撑下的高考志愿填报在线咨询系统设计与实现[D].西南大学,2012.

  • 相关阅读:
    编程思想
    为什么静态成员、静态方法中不能用this和super关键字
    C#中静态与非静态方法比较
    数组,集合,列表的使用与区别
    2017-3-23 网络IP
    [精彩] 关于DB2的内存分配
    DB2 常用命令
    SQL0973N在 "<堆名>" 堆中没有足够的存储器可用来处理语句
    DB2通用数据库性能调整的常用方法
    创建DB2数据库联合对象
  • 原文地址:https://www.cnblogs.com/blog1175077321/p/11884871.html
走看看 - 开发者的网上家园